Plants play a very important role in their environment. They represent the main source of nutrition for all herbivores, and they are also responsible for many gaseous exchanges.
Photosynthesis is the process by which a plant converts carbon dioxide into oxygen using light. However, another gaseous exchange, called respiration, also occurs in a plant’s leaves.
During respiration, the plant takes in oxygen and releases carbon dioxide, just like humans do when they breathe. In short, this gaseous exchange is the opposite of photosynthesis.
Photosynthesis takes place during the day while respiration is more obvious at night, when photosynthesis stops.
